New Delhi, Apr 30 (ANI): Director Michael Anderson, who received an Oscar nomination for ‘Around the World in 80 Days’breathed his last. He was 98. He worked on many war films like The Dam Busters (1955), The Yangtse Incident (1957) and Operation Crossbow (1965). He died in Vancouver, a spokeswoman for his family told hollywoodreporter.comAnderson is survived by his third wife, actress Adrianne Ellis, two sons and a step daughter. Anderson’s autobiography, titled Directed by…, will be published soon.
